Does your child have an interest in marine science? Do they love going to the beach and finding animals? If so, this is their chance to learn more about it! Send them to Tampa Bay Watch this summer for some fun in the sun with our marine ecology summer camps where they will learn about amazing Tampa Bay and its inhabitants!
Tampa Bay Watch offers two exciting, fun-filled summer camp options! Sea Monkeys is a camp is for kids ages 6-8 and offers an introduction to the marine environment. Tampa Bay Discovery camp is for kids ages 9-14 and offers an in depth look at what makes Tampa Bay one of the most incredible estuaries in the world! Both camps take place at our Marine and Education Center. This ideal location on the Shell Key Preserve, which boasts rich mangrove forests, grass flats and shallow waters teeming with marine life, provides a perfect setting for our summer campers to engage in hands-on opportunities to learn about marine ecology and participate in restoration projects. Our facility features an outdoor classroom complete with a fully equipped wet-lab and large aquarium tanks, while our indoor laboratory classroom houses lab equipment, interactive touch tanks, and interpretive murals.
